A 2021 research study located that autumn avoidance education and learning enhanced recognition as well as some actions modification among older adults in neighborhood settings relying on the high quality and evidence-based nature of the remedy. Defining autumn avoidance education as a relatively low-cost intervention, the research study noted it was much more reliable when carried out by collaborative nurses or care managers.

The VISN 8 Client Safety And Security Facility of Inquiry site supplies a variety of product on drops avoidance. The Online Key Treatment Loss Prevention and Administration Toolkit's key goal is to share confirmed fall threat assessment testing tool choices with HBPC staff. Amongst the product is a brochure, Danger Variables Connected With Falling and What to Do When You Loss, given as a guide for individuals on blood slimmers and the dangers connected with drops.


The material is in the general public domain name and some of it is available in numerous languages. A 13-minute video on osteoporosis is also offered and was prepared by the VISN 8 Client Security Center of Inquiry, funded by Merck & Co, Inc., and created by the College of South Florida Wellness Library.
